Question: about 3 to 4 hours ago i started feeling a numbness tingly feeling in my upper right lip is this something i should be concerned about i am - 27 years felmale i also have had a sore throat and ear pain the past 2 days
doctor
Answered by Dr. Michelle Gibson James (38 minutes later)
Brief Answer:
may be due to viral infection

Detailed Answer:
HI, thanks for using healthcare magic

Sore throat and ear pain are usually related to a viral infection affecting the respiratory tract.
It may be due to the cold or , in more severe cases, due to the flu virus (would have aches and pains in muscles/joints, lethargy, headache etc)

Sore throat can sometimes be due to bacterial infection with strep (strep throat). In that case, a fever is present (lasting at least 3 days or more ), no improvement with throat pain over 2 to 3 days or worsening
Ear infection can be due to a bacterial infection of the ear.

If a bacterial infection of the ear or throat is present, then you would need a course of antibiotics.
If your symptoms are worsening or the pain is severe, this means that it may be bacterial and you would need to be seen by your doctor to be assessed.

In terms of the numbness and tingling of the lip, this can sometimes occur with viral infections because the immune system is impaired since it is trying to fight another infection.
It can sometimes be due to cold sore acting up, if you have a previous history of cold sore.

If there is no history of a cold sore then you can monitor to see if any changes occur.
